Behavioral task
behavioral1
Sample
a2ac2318036ffb3c8041952f4f39e65d_JaffaCakes118.exe
Resource
win7-20240729-en
Behavioral task
behavioral2
Sample
a2ac2318036ffb3c8041952f4f39e65d_JaffaCakes118.exe
Resource
win10v2004-20240802-en
General
-
Target
a2ac2318036ffb3c8041952f4f39e65d_JaffaCakes118
-
Size
312KB
-
MD5
a2ac2318036ffb3c8041952f4f39e65d
-
SHA1
dd4f2df558d963fd9617ed9ab89206692d754184
-
SHA256
77787866ddf4edc879274f6a63118238acad99c11f58d0675433f70db96e3836
-
SHA512
4bcc822a40fa77792bb87e3cb26dda0d9f9ea7abd5fbf1a008f497bb15b10503090e08504d5755a5bafb471313a929d82da7178466f5748a841ce0572dc12298
-
SSDEEP
6144:CJgVMVeyAW6CcSmIr24ZPWPVdZB9CB+Z+SpkX9z4fARsMt9xVoKl:CPedjH+0ZB9C4J64fARsM7xV1
Malware Config
Signatures
-
resource yara_rule sample upx -
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ource a2ac2318036ffb3c8041952f4f39e65d_JaffaCakes118
Files
-
a2ac2318036ffb3c8041952f4f39e65d_JaffaCakes118.exe windows:4 windows x86 arch:x86
274fdb64142fe8b5d3237c7ee5eda442
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LINE_NUMS_STRIPPED
IMAGE_FILE_LOCAL_SYMS_STRIPPED
IMAGE_FILE_32BIT_MACHINE
Imports
kernel32
GetWindowsDirectoryA
FreeLibrary
GetProcAddress
LoadLibraryA
GetPrivateProfileStringA
GetTempPathA
GetSystemDirectoryA
GetModuleFileNameA
LCMapStringW
LCMapStringA
IsBadCodePtr
IsBadReadPtr
SetUnhandledExceptionFilter
WriteFile
GetFileType
GetStdHandle
SetHandleCount
GetEnvironmentStringsW
GetEnvironmentStrings
OutputDebugStringA
FreeEnvironmentStringsA
UnhandledExceptionFilter
GetStringTypeW
GetStringTypeA
GetOEMCP
GetACP
GetCPInfo
IsBadWritePtr
VirtualAlloc
VirtualFree
HeapCreate
GetVersionExA
GetEnvironmentVariableA
HeapSize
TerminateProcess
TlsGetValue
SetLastError
TlsAlloc
TlsSetValue
RaiseException
ExitProcess
GetVersion
GetCommandLineA
GetStartupInfoA
GetModuleHandleA
HeapAlloc
HeapReAlloc
HeapFree
RtlUnwind
LocalFree
InterlockedExchange
DebugBreak
WideCharToMultiByte
lstrcmpA
GlobalLock
GlobalUnlock
FindResourceA
LoadResource
LockResource
lstrlenW
GlobalAlloc
GlobalHandle
GlobalFree
FreeResource
MulDiv
DeleteCriticalSection
HeapDestroy
InitializeCriticalSection
EnterCriticalSection
LeaveCriticalSection
CreateMutexA
GetLastError
CloseHandle
lstrcmpiA
MultiByteToWideChar
InterlockedIncrement
GetCurrentThreadId
GetCurrentProcess
FlushInstructionCache
lstrlenA
InterlockedDecrement
FreeEnvironmentStringsW
Sleep
user32
ExitWindowsEx
GetWindowDC
wvsprintfA
InvalidateRgn
CreateAcceleratorTableA
GetDesktopWindow
GetClassNameA
EnumWindows
IsChild
SetFocus
BeginPaint
GetSysColorBrush
EndPaint
RegisterWindowMessageA
CreateDialogIndirectParamA
GetFocus
DefWindowProcA
DestroyCursor
InvalidateRect
GetSysColor
LoadImageA
RedrawWindow
IsWindow
GetIconInfo
SendMessageA
ReleaseCapture
WindowFromPoint
ClientToScreen
SetCapture
GetClassInfoExA
wsprintfA
RegisterClassExA
GetMessagePos
UpdateWindow
SetRect
LoadCursorA
GetMessageA
TranslateMessage
DispatchMessageA
CharLowerA
DestroyWindow
PostQuitMessage
EnableWindow
GetCapture
GetParent
GetActiveWindow
CallWindowProcA
MessageBoxA
DestroyIcon
GetWindow
SystemParametersInfoA
MapWindowPoints
SetWindowPos
GetSystemMetrics
CreateDialogParamA
MoveWindow
SetForegroundWindow
IsDialogMessageA
CreatePopupMenu
AppendMenuA
IsMenu
TrackPopupMenu
DestroyMenu
SetWindowTextA
EnumChildWindows
GetDlgItem
ShowWindow
CreateWindowExA
FillRect
GetWindowLongA
SetWindowLongA
LoadStringA
FrameRect
InflateRect
GetWindowTextLengthA
GetWindowTextA
DrawTextA
DrawFocusRect
DrawStateA
CopyRect
OffsetRect
GetDC
GetClientRect
GetWindowRect
ReleaseDC
SetCursor
GetDlgCtrlID
PeekMessageA
GetCursorPos
ScreenToClient
CharNextA
gdi32
CreatePatternBrush
PatBlt
GetDeviceCaps
CreateFontIndirectA
StretchBlt
DeleteDC
SelectObject
CreateCompatibleBitmap
CreateCompatibleDC
BitBlt
Rectangle
GetStockObject
SetTextColor
SetBkColor
DeleteObject
ExtTextOutA
CreateBitmap
GetObjectA
CreateSolidBrush
SetBkMode
LineTo
MoveToEx
CreatePen
advapi32
RegOpenKeyExA
LookupPrivilegeValueA
OpenProcessToken
RegCloseKey
RegQueryValueExA
AdjustTokenPrivileges
shell32
ShellExecuteA
ole32
OleLockRunning
CoTaskMemAlloc
StringFromCLSID
CoTaskMemFree
OleUninitialize
OleInitialize
CreateStreamOnHGlobal
CoInitialize
CoUninitialize
CLSIDFromString
CoCreateInstance
CLSIDFromProgID
oleaut32
SysFreeString
VariantClear
VariantChangeType
SysAllocStringLen
SysStringLen
SysAllocString
LoadRegTypeLi
OleCreateFontIndirect
GetErrorInfo
CreateErrorInfo
VariantInit
comctl32
ImageList_Create
ImageList_ReplaceIcon
InitCommonControlsEx
version
GetFileVersionInfoSizeA
GetFileVersionInfoA
VerQueryValueA
Sections
.text Size: 136KB - Virtual size: 134K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rdata Size: 16KB - Virtual size: 14K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 16KB - Virtual size: 15K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 36KB - Virtual size: 36K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.UPX0 Size: 104KB - Virtual size: 252K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E